Phonotaxis of the African Mole Cricket, Gryllotalpa africana Palisot de Beauvois (땅강아지의 주음성에 관한 연구)

  • Phonotaxis of the African mole cricket, Gryllotalpa africana palisot de Beauvois, was investigated in 1990 and 1992 at the agronomy Experiment Station of Korea Ginseng & Tobacco Research Institute in Hwaseong-gun, Kyonggi-do, Male adults produced calling sounds (calling songs) through the openings of subsurface burrows. Intensities of the sound were 77-80 dB at 15 cm above the openings. When tape recordings of male calling songs were broadcasted outdoors at 105-110 dB by two horn speakers installed at the center of a 1.4 m diameter-funnel, flying adults were attracted for 1.5 hours from about 30 minutes after sunset. Among attracted adults, 14.3-16.9% landed in the funnel, and 65.7-74.7% landed on the ground within 2m form the sound source. Females were 66.7-74.3%, which seemed to be due to the sex ratio of the population in the field. Adults landing in the funnel and at the distance of within 2m from the center of the funnel were tend to be a little more than those attracted to a blacklight trap.

Selection of Systemic Chemicals and Attractiveness of Sunflower to Ricania spp.(Hemiptera: Ricaniidae) Adults (갈색날개매미충 성충에 대한 해바라기의 유인력과 침투이행성 약제 선발)

  • Sunflower, selected as a trap plant that can be controlled by attracting Ricania spp. adults via attraction has the highest attractiveness during the preoviposition period. Considering the ecological characteristics of Ricania spp., adults are distinguished by the preoviposition and oviposition periods and the attractiveness of sunflower to Ricania spp. adults was 91.4~95.2% higher than that of blueberry during the preoviposition period. On August 20, when Ricania spp. adults entered the oviposition season, sunflower attractiveness was low at 9.8~11.6% owing to preference for tree species. Based on the result of the selection of systemic chemicals that could be used concomitantly with sunflower, all chemicals, except etofenprox, showed a high controlling effect of over 90%, and among them, dinotefuran showed the highest insecticidal rate of 95.8%. The systemic chemicals acetamiprid, dinotefuran, thiamethoxam, and imidacloprid persisted for 13 days (survey period). Therefore, the concomitant use of sunflower and systemic chemicals can reduce the density of Ricania spp. entering farmlands and their populations in surrounding habitats, which are expected to help in stabilizing the ecosystem.

Effects of Light Trap Structure and Lamp Type on the Attraction of Chestnut Pests in an Orchard (밤재배원에서 유살등 구조 및 램프의 종류가 해충 유인력에 미치는 영향)

  • The effects of insect capture were studied in a chestnut orchard using three different light traps (A, B, and C type) with various lamps. The mercury lamp trap captured 125 insect species, out of which 115 were chestnut pests. The B and C type light traps, comprising a Dulux-EL white lamp, were examined for their capturing ability. The type B trap attracted Coleopteran insects (83%), while type C captured Lepidopteran insects (73%). The mercury clarity lamp along with the type B light trap was most effective in attracting Curculio sikkimensis adults (mean, 9.8 adults), while the Dulux-EL lamp captured the highest number of Dichocrocis punctiferalis adults (mean, 10.2 adults) using the type C light trap. These results suggest that selection of the appropriate types of light traps and lamps based on the target pest species is critical in ensuring effective and eco-friendly control of the pest population.

Monitoring Technique of Pumpkin Fruit Flies Using Terpinyl Acetate-Protein Diet Lure and Development of Its Spraying Formulation for The Fly Control (Terpinyl acetate-단백질먹이 유인제를 이용한 호박과실파리류 연중발생 모니터링 기술 및 살포용 방제 제형 개발)

  • Two tephritid fruit flies are infesting pumpkins in Korea. Both are classified into genus of Zeugodacus. The striped fruit fly, Z. scutellata, males are attracted to a lure called Cuelure (CL), which has been used to monitor the occurrence of this fruit fly in the crop field. In contrast, no effective male lure was not developed to monitor the pumpkin fruit fly, Z. depressa. Protein diet lure has been used to attract females of most fruit flies. The addition of terpinyl acetate (TA) was effective to increase the attractiveness of Z. depressa. This study aimed to monitor the occurrence of Z. depressa in pumpkin field with TA-protein diet lure. To validate the efficiency of TA-protein diet lure, Z. scutellata was monitored in a year of 2019 using CL and TA-protein diet lures, and the yearly monitoring data were compared. The occurrence patterns derived from both lures were similar except late season after October. The extended catches of TA-protein diet lure might be explained by the adult diapause induction of Z. scutellata at late September. Monitoring Z. depressa with TA-protein diet lure gave two peaks at mid July and August-September, in which more than 80% catches were females. Based on the attractiveness of TA-protein diet lure, its wettable powder with an addition of spinosad insecticide was formulated and sprayed to pumpkin crops. After 7 days post-spray, the control efficacy recorded more than 70%. However, the control efficacies decreased as the time progressed after the spray. These results demonstrated the application of TA-protein diet lure for monitoring occurrence of Z. depressa in pumpkin-cultivating field conditions. The wettable powder containing spinosad can be applied to develop a new control agent against two pumpkin fruit flies.

Evaluation of Pheromone Lure of Grapholita molesta (Lpidoptera: Torticidae) and Forecasting Its Phenological Events in Suwon (복숭아순나방 성페로몬 미끼 평가 및 수원지역에서 주요 발생시기 예찰)

  • The sex pheromone blend (28-12AC : E8-12AC : Z8-12OH = 95 : 5 : 1) of oriental fruit moth, Grapholita molesta (Busck), was evaluated with reference to its male attractivity at different dosage and lure longevity of 1.0 mg in a field condition. Also, degree-days (DD) were calculated up to major phenological events of G. molesta using seasonal adult flights monitored by pheromone traps and egg population densities in early season in Suwon peach orchards. In the range of 0.1-4.0 mg dosage examined, G. molesta males caught in pheromone trap decreased with increasing total pheromone doses. The highest number of G. molesta males were attracted in traps baited with 0.1 mg-lure, and there were no significantly differences among 0.5 to 4.0 mg-lure. In longevity test with a 1.0 mg-lure, there was no difference in mean numbers of G. molesta males caught between traps with fresh-baited lures every 20d and field-lasted lures up to ${\approx}50d$ after trap installation, but thereafter more G. molesta males were attracted in the field-lasted lures than in the fresh-baited lures. Accumulated degree-days (DD) from January 1 to the first adult emergence (biofix) were 39DD at a lower threshold temperature $8.1^{\circ}C$. Degree-days from the biofix up to the 1st adult peak through 4th peak were 98DD, 620DD, 1233DD, and 1916DD, respectively. Required degree-days from the 1st adult peak to the 1st egg peak were 130DD, while the 2nd egg peak timing was simultaneous with the 2nd adult peak. Further, management strategies of G. molesta were discussed in peach orchards.
